International Tax

The growth in the global economy has led more and more businesses to expand through overseas opportunities and trade. One of the key costs incurred through cross border activities is tax, and an efficient structure can help set you on the road to success.

Enterprise Network Worldwide

We have specialists, who are supported by taxation advisors within our membership of Enterprise Network Worldwide, a network of independent accounting associated offices, in several cities worldwide.

We have the ability to add the international dimension to the general tax services we deliver. Our skills enable us to provide practical business solutions in the following areas:

  • Cross border group structuring
  • Trading through a branch.
  • Dividend, interest and royalty planning.
  • Transfer pricing.
  • Tax, and social security and remuneration package planning for inbound and outbound executives.
  • International VAT and Customs issues.
